Growth Anchored in Faith by Ainatul Aqilah Kamarudin, Jarita Duasa, Salina Kassim & Riasat Amin Imon
Synopsis
What if finance could be more than numbers and profit? What if it became a source of hope, a path to fairness, and a promise of dignity and shared prosperity? Imagine an economy where wealth is not only created, but also cared for, circulating with compassion, justice, and trust. Growth Anchored in Faith invites readers to reimagine the purpose of finance through the values of Islamic economics. With faith as its compass, this book shows how finance can serve people instead of markets, uplift communities instead of dividing them, and transform growth into something meaningful and lasting. Blending history, policy, and vision, it reflects on Malaysia’s journey in Islamic finance and the lessons it offers for a more just and inclusive future. More than an academic study, this book is a call to reconnect prosperity with purpose. It is for scholars, students, policymakers, and dreamers who believe that true growth is measured not by profit alone, but by the well-being of society and the mercy of the Divine.
